SQLSERVER SQL基础:SQL Server的触发器详解 一、概念 触发器是一种特殊类型的存储过程,不由用户直接调用。 创建触发器时会对其进行定义,以便在对特定表或列作特定类型的数据修改时执行。 触发器可以查询其他表,而且可以包含复杂的SQL语句。 它们主要用于强制服从复杂的业务规则或要求。 例如,您可以根据客户...
MySQL MySQL优化之:Mysql体系化探讨令人头疼的JOIN运算 前言 之前经历过从零到一初创项目,也有海量数据项目;总体来说当项目在逐渐发展过程中如何构建一个安全可靠,稳定的数据存储一直是项目中最核心、最重要、最关键部分,没有之一 接下来我会体系化输出存储系列文章;本篇文章我们先谈一下数据中一个最令人头疼的连接运算&m...
MySQL 异常处理之:MySQL安装时一直卡在starting server的问题及如何解决的方法 5.注册表删完之后,然后可以重新安转了. 如果出现这种情况的话那么就是两个原因: 1.有可能你的计算机名是中文的,所以在安装时生成的日志文件默认是中文名,导致卡住. 2. 你之前安装过 MySQL,并且重新装的时候没有卸载干净. 现在我们从卸载到重装来一遍...
MySQL 教你如何MySQL8.0.20单机多实例部署步骤方法 0.环境需要 1.准备Linux环境(系统:CentOS7)2.准备MySQL安装包(版本:8.0.20)3.安装方式为:msyql解压安装 1.安装步骤 1.下载解压安装的mysql安装包文件 下载地址:https://cdn.mysql.com/arc...
Windows 如何在window下使用Jenkins来做自动化部署的详细步骤说明截图 今天我们来说一下,如何使用Jenkins+powershell脚本,将我们的.NET CORE的脚本部署到对应的服务器上. 这里我们使用的源码管理工具是TFS.虽然源码管理器比较老旧,但是原理都差不多. 1.安装Jre,因为我们的Jenkins是基于jav...
Windows 教你阿里云windows server2019如何配置FTP服务的完整步骤截图 1.在windowsserver菜单中打开服务器管理器 2. 在快速启动仪表盘中选择配置角色服务 3. 直接下一步 4. 选择基于角色或基于功能的安装,下一步 5. 选择要配置ftp服务的服务器,下一步 6. 选择Web服务器下面的选项 7. 功能选项里网...
SQLSERVER sqlserver主键自增如何实现的方法 建表,主键自增 create table aaa( id bigint identity(1,1) not null PRIMARY key, name nvarchar(255) ); navicat没办法给主键列,加identity,只能用sql建表 ...
MySQL 如何解决mysql幻读详解实例以及解决方法 总结 脏读/不可重复读的概念都比较容易理解和掌握,这里不在讨论 事务隔离级别(tx_isolation) mysql 有四级事务隔离级别 每个级别都有字符或数字编号 级别 symbol 值 描述 读未提交 READ-UNCOMMITTED 0 存在脏读、不...
SQLSERVER 如何在SQLServer中使用JSON文档型数据的查询及问题解决 近日在项目中遇到一个问题: 如何在报表中统计JSON格式存储的数据? 例如有个调查问卷记录表,记录每个问题的答案。 其结构示意如下(横表设计) Id user date Q1_Answer Q2_Answer Q3_Answer 行Id 答题用户 答题日期...
Oracle Oracle数据库备份还原详解 理论准备 oracle 数据库提供expdp和impdp命令用于备份和恢复数据库。 具体可查阅oracle官方文档 https://docs.oracle.com/en/database/oracle/oracle-database/12.2/sutil/...
SQLSERVER SQL基础:SQL利用游标遍历日期查询的过程详解 需求:我有个存储过程,每次执行需要带入一个连续的日期。我想遍历执行出一个月的时间,怎么搞? 我本来的想法是:程序里面写一个for循环,循环里面循环传日期去执行这个存储过程。 但是同事告诉我用游标,我从来没用过,就尝试了一下,没想到成功了哈哈,记录一下! &...
SQLSERVER SQL基础:SQL Server中的游标介绍 游标是面向行的,它会使开发人员变懒,懒得去想用面向集合的查询方式实现某些功能。 在性能上,游标会吃更多的内存,减少可用的并发,占用带宽,锁定资源,当然还有更多的代码量。用一个比喻来说明为什么游标会占用更多的资源。当你从ATM机取款的时候,是一次取1000的...